The provisional State of the Global Climate report by the World Meteorological Organization (WMO), issued November 30, confirms that 2023 is set to be the warmest year on record. The past nine years, 2015 to 2023, were also the warmest on record. “Greenhouse gas levels are record high. Global temperatures are record high. Sea level rise is record high. Antarctic sea ice is record low. It’s a deafening cacophony of broken records,” said WMO Secretary-General Prof. Petteri Taalas.

The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change has said, "The scientific evidence is unequivocal: climate change is a threat to human wellbeing and the health of the planet. Any further delay in concerted global action will miss the brief, rapidly closing window to secure a liveable future."

But there is a bright side. The world is on the cusp of a once-in-a-generation clean energy effort. The federal government of the United States has committed $8 Billion to fund regional hydrogen production hubs strategically placed throughout the country.

OneSix Energy is based in Detroit, Michigan, which is part of the Midwest Hydrogen Hub consisting of Michigan, Illinois, and Indiana. The hub will focus efforts around developing regional supply chains for the fuel source. The goal is to create a market for fueling trucks and heavy-duty vehicles with clean hydrogen, which comes without any tailpipe emissions.

Hydrogen Power made efficient

Avoiding the ravages of climate change requires inexpensive carbon-free energy sources. Yet, our society is built around the enormous amounts of natural gas being produced each year - enough to continuously power a half-billion lightbulbs. Practicality demands that we find a way to cleanly use methane rather than replace it.

Methane pyrolysis should be the key to this practical approach. It, in theory, produces hydrogen, which is a clean fuel. It also produces solid carbon powder with only trace greenhouse gasses. Scanning the marketplace, the lack of methane pyrolysis companies suggests there are significant challenges that have prevented theory from becoming reality.
